Delatestryl (testosterone enanthate)
type of
Delatestryl (testosterone enanthate) is an androgen, a male sex hormone, used in men who do not make enough of a natural substance called testosterone. Delatestryl is available in generic form.
This drug may have the following side effects:
- nausea,
- headache,
- vomiting,
- depression,
- anxiety,
- numbness or tingly feeling,
- hair loss,
- oily skin,
- acne, and
- skin color changes,
- injection site reactions (pain, redness, or swelling).
- increased or decreased sexual interest,
- breast swelling in men,
